Often take royal jelly, what effect can you have on people's health?
Royal jelly is rich in vitamins and minerals, which has a good health care effect on human body. Royal jelly can enhance autoimmune ability, lower blood sugar and resist oxidation. Royal jelly can reduce blood lipid and blood pressure, control vasodilation, protect the liver, and play an anti-inflammatory and antibacterial role. However, royal jelly should not be eaten excessively, so it should be taken properly. Blood sugar is high, so you can take it in small amount; People with diarrhea, abdominal pain or gastrointestinal dysfunction can't eat royal jelly, which will cause severe contraction of gastrointestinal tract and aggravate symptoms.

Long-term consumption of royal jelly may cause allergic reactions. Because royal jelly contains a certain amount of foreign proteins (non-human foreign proteins), a few allergic people may have allergic reactions after eating royal jelly, ranging from abnormal reactions such as chest tightness, rash and itchy skin to dyspnea, loss of consciousness and even anaphylactic shock. Long-term consumption of royal jelly may cause endocrine disorders, because royal jelly contains a certain amount of hormones and hormone-like components, of which short-term consumption of a small amount will generally not have a great impact on the body, but long-term consumption of royal jelly in large quantities may destroy the hormone balance in the body, and even cause a series of health problems due to hormone imbalance in the body.

Royal jelly contains estrogen, which is easy to cause precocious puberty in children, so it is not recommended for children to take royal jelly. Pregnant women taking a small amount of royal jelly during pregnancy is not conducive to the growth and development of the fetus, and can cause abortion in severe cases. Royal jelly contains pollen. Once people are allergic to pollen, taking royal jelly is not recommended. Royal jelly can cause gastrointestinal tract contraction and aggravate the condition of patients with gastrointestinal diseases.
